Subject: Thornquist component library cut-over complete

Hi — the cut-over to semantic versioning for the Thornquist shared component library finished last night. All consumer apps now pin minor versions; the legacy tag scheme is retired. Nothing pending in the release branch. For your review, the publish pipeline now runs with the settings below.

config for hahaf-kafof:
[wenys]
host = wenys.torvahq.corp
user = wenys_svc
database = wenys_prod

Alert: SQL lint failures — Pondermill CI

This alert fires when committed SQL files violate the Quarrylint ruleset: unqualified table names, missing statement terminators, or disallowed SELECT * in migrations. It is non-blocking for now but will become a hard gate next quarter, so fix violations promptly. Run the linter locally before pushing to avoid noise. The full rule list and suppression guidelines are published on the internal standards page.

runbook for badug-kadup: https://confluence.zemvarlabs.internal/projects/browse/display/projects/bd1b

## Deployment

Crumbline enforces the order-cutoff rule server-side: orders placed after the cutoff roll to the next bake day. The cutoff is timezone-aware per storefront, so don't hardcode offsets. Deploys go through the usual pipeline; the only manual step is confirming the cutoff values match the bakery's posted hours. Before approving, verify the service starts with the following configuration.

settings of bawif-fawif:
ralix:
  log_level: warn
  metrics_host: metrics.ralix.tolvaqsys.internal
  pool_size: 32

Hi all — welcome to the team, and here's where things stand. Yesterday we finished migrating the public Lanternfish REST API from offset-based to cursor-based pagination. All list endpoints now return an opaque cursor token; offset parameters are accepted but ignored, with a deprecation header, until the next major release. Client SDKs were updated in lockstep, and the gateway rewrites legacy requests transparently. Error budgets held throughout. For reference, the pagination service now runs with the following configuration values.

config for tagep-yajef:
ulawyn:
  log_level: error
  metrics_host: metrics.ulawyn.lumiclabs.internal
  pin: 0564
  pool_size: 32